This picks up right after the end of The Little Yellow Dog - it's as if chapter 1 of Brawly Brown is just the next chapter of Yellow Dog, you just turned the page. This is a new story, of course - a new set of bad guys, cops and people who just have the bad luck to be drawn into it. The story is also a vehicle for Mosley to touch on the existence of groups like the Black Panthers. He briefly covers how the groups include those who truly have noble objectives and those who have other motives - as well as how Police and other officials try to subvert them. The book is very good - I gave it 3 stars because I didn't think it was quite as good as the previous one. But it's really 3.75.
